What are some common collaborative opportunities for a Postdoctoral Position in Gut Microbiome research?

Postdoctoral researchers in gut microbiome studies frequently collaborate with multidisciplinary teams, including clinicians, bioinformaticians, and molecular biologists. These collaborations are essential for integrating clinical data with laboratory findings and complex data analysis. Engaging with diverse experts not only enriches research outcomes but also provides valuable networking and learning opportunities, which can lead to co-authorship on high-impact publications and future career prospects. Regular lab meetings, joint grant applications, and shared projects are typical collaborative activities in this field.

What is a postdoctoral position in gut microbiome research?

A postdoctoral position in gut microbiome research is a temporary research role for individuals who have recently completed their PhD in a related field, such as microbiology, biology, or biomedical sciences. In this position, the researcher works under the supervision of a principal investigator to conduct advanced studies on the communities of microorganisms living in the human gut. The goal is often to better understand how the gut microbiome affects health and disease, and the work may involve laboratory experiments, data analysis, and publication of research findings. These positions help researchers develop new skills and prepare for independent academic or industry careers.

What are the key skills and qualifications needed to thrive in a Postdoctoral Position focused on the Gut Microbiome, and why are they important?

A successful candidate for a Postdoctoral Position in the Gut Microbiome typically holds a PhD in microbiology, molecular biology, or a related field, with expertise in experimental design and data analysis. Familiarity with next-generation sequencing platforms, bioinformatics tools (such as QIIME or R), and statistical software is often required. Strong analytical thinking, problem-solving abilities, and effective communication skills help researchers collaborate across disciplines and present complex findings clearly. These competencies are crucial for advancing scientific understanding, producing impactful research, and contributing to interdisciplinary teams.

Job description

The Postdoctoral Fellow will participate in translational and clinical research focused on the role of the gut microbiome in cancer biology, cancer immunotherapy response, gastrointestinal diseases, and microbiome-based therapeutic strategies. The fellow will contribute to multidisciplinary projects integrating microbiome science, immuno-oncology, gastroenterology, and translational medicine.
Responsibilities include participation in prospective clinical and translational studies evaluating microbiome dynamics, antibiotic exposure, fecal microbiota transplantation (FMT), live biotherapeutic products, and immune-related outcomes in patients receiving immune checkpoint inhibitors, hematopoietic stem cell transplantation, and cellular therapies. Additional responsibilities include biospecimen and clinical data coordination, scientific literature review, manuscript preparation, presentation of research findings, and collaboration with multidisciplinary research teams.
The position provides training and research experience in gut microbiome science, cancer immunotherapy, translational oncology, gastrointestinal diseases, and microbiome-based therapeutics within an internationally recognized academic cancer center environment.
All duties and responsibilities are carried out in compliance with institutional policies, ethical research standards, and applicable federal and state regulations.
